Brevard commissioners authorize staff talks with Space Florida as wastewater study continues

Brevard County Board of County Commissioners · December 3, 2024
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Faced with concerns about capacity, industrial discharges and taxpayer exposure, the commission directed staff to meet with Space Florida and vet letters from state agencies and industry as the county evaluates short‑ and long‑term wastewater options for the barrier islands.

The Brevard County Commission on Dec. 3 directed county staff to meet with Space Florida and other parties to vet correspondence and technical issues tied to proposals for handling wastewater from expanding space‑related industrial activity on North Merritt Island.
